Understanding the Tenleytown Real Estate Market
Before we jump into the selling process, it’s crucial that we familiarize ourselves with the local Tenleytown real estate market.
Tenleytown is a vibrant neighborhood known for its mix of single-family homes, rowhouses, and apartments. Its blend of urban convenience and residential charm makes it appealing for families and young professionals alike. Understanding this context helps us position our home effectively in a competitive environment.
Current Market Trends
When we think about selling our home fast, staying informed about market trends becomes essential.
-
Average Home Prices: In Tenleytown, average home prices have shown a steady increase over the past few years, making it a great time to sell. Knowing the average selling price allows us to set a competitive yet fair price.
-
Days on Market: Homes in the area typically sell within a specific timeframe. After analyzing recent sales, we can see that homes often get snatched up within 30–60 days. This knowledge lets us strategize our approach effectively.
-
Buyer Preferences: Today’s buyers often look for modern amenities, energy efficiency, and low-maintenance homes. We need to consider how our property aligns with these preferences to appeal to potential buyers.
Preparing Our Home for Sale
Now that we have a grasp of the market, the next step is preparing our home for sale. This stage is critical as first impressions matter greatly.
Decluttering and Cleaning
One of the most impactful steps we can take is decluttering our space. Potential buyers need to envision themselves in our home, and excess items can hinder that vision.
-
Start Small: We can begin in one room at a time, sorting our belongings into keep, sell, or donate categories.
-
Deep Clean: A spotless home isn’t just more inviting; it can also justify a higher asking price. Hiring professional cleaners or dedicating a weekend to detay cleaning can make a significant difference.
Making Needed Repairs
While we might be tempted to sell our home as-is, making necessary repairs can significantly accelerate the sales process and increase our property’s value.
-
Focus on Major Areas: Leaky faucets, cracked tiles, or peeling paint can deter potential buyers. Addressing these issues not only enhances the appeal but also builds trust with buyers.
-
Cosmetic Improvements: Small improvements like a fresh coat of paint or updated fixtures can enhance the perception of our home. Simple upgrades often yield high returns on investment.
Pricing Our Home Competitively
Pricing is perhaps one of the most crucial elements of selling our home quickly. An overpriced home can sit on the market for months, while an underpriced one might cause us to miss out on potential profits.
Conducting a Comparative Market Analysis (CMA)
Before we can set a price, we should look at a Comparative Market Analysis (CMA).
-
Analyzing Similar Properties: By examining recently sold homes in Tenleytown that are similar in size, condition, and location, we can determine a competitive price.
-
Adjusting for Unique Features: If our home has features that set it apart, like a renovated kitchen or a large backyard, we can price it slightly higher, but still within reason.

Evaluating Offers and Closing the Deal
Once the showings start, offers may begin to come in. Evaluating these offers thoughtfully is crucial.
Understanding Offer Terms
When we receive an offer, we should carefully assess not only the price but also the terms of the offer.
-
Contingencies: Are there contingencies attached to the offer? Things like financing and home inspections can delay the process.
-
Closing Timeline: A quicker closing timeline may be advantageous if we need to sell fast, so we should weigh the offer’s timeline closely against our needs.
Counteroffer Strategies
If an offer is lower than we hoped, a counteroffer may be warranted.
-
Be Reasonable: Setting our counteroffer slightly above our minimum acceptable price can leave room for negotiation.
-
Stay Calm: The process can feel personal, but keeping our emotions in check can lead to better outcomes.
